Swedish Apple Cake

How to Make Swedish Apple Cake

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up butter, room temperature
  • 1 2/3 cup s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 4 cups chopped apples
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• Powdered sugar for dusting (optional)

Directions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13 inch baking pan.
  2.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Beat in the eggs, one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
  4. Stir in the vanilla extract.
  5. In a separate b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t.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et mixture and mix until just combined.
  6. Fold in the chopped apples until evenly distributed.
  7.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and spread it evenly.
  8.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  9. Allow to cool, then dust with powdered sugar before serving. Enjoy!

How to Serve Swedish Apple Cake

Serve the Swedish Apple Cake warm or at room temperature. It pairs perfectly with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a dollop of whipped cream. You can also add a sprinkle of cinnamon for extra flavor.

How to Store Swedish Apple Cake

To store the cake, keep it in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you want to keep it longer, you can freeze it. Wrap the cooled cake t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il. It can last in the freezer for up to three months.

Tips to Make Swedish Apple Cake

  • Make sure the butter is at room temperature for easy mixing.
  • Use a mix of apple varieties for deeper flavor and different textures.
  • Don’t overmix the batter; this keeps the cake light and fluffy.

Variation

You can add nuts, such as walnuts or pecans, for an added crunch. You may also substitute the apples with other fruits like pears or peaches to create your own twist on this classic cake.

FAQs

1. Can I use other fruits instead of apples?
Yes! You can use pears or peaches for a different taste.

2. Can I make this cake 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are it a day ahead and store it in an airtight container.

3. Is it necessary to dust with powdered sugar?
No, it’s optional. The cake tastes great without it, but the sugar adds a nice touch for presentation.
